A Tris-Chelate Nickel Complex of Formylhydrazine: Synthesis and Crystal Structure
Journal of Structural Chemistry ( IF 0.8 ) Pub Date : 2024-03-01 , DOI: 10.1134/s0022476624020136
A. A. Zabolotnyi , O. P. Demidov , S. B. Zaichenko , A. V. Bicherov , N. V. Ter-Oganessian

Abstract

The Ni(FH)3Cl2·H2O complex is prepared by the in situ reaction of formic acid, hydrazine hydrate, and nickel(II) chloride. It is structurally characterized as a tris-chelated complex cation containing chloride anions as counterions and crystallizing in the P21/c centrosymmetric monoclinic space group.
